Cam locks are one of the most widely deployed locking mechanisms in industrial and commercial settings — from server racks and electrical panels to vending equipment and office furniture. But are they actually secure? The answer depends entirely on the design tier. Standard cam locks offer basic mechanical protection for low-security applications. Security cam locks are engineered with layered disc tumbler designs, anti-drill steel ball protection, and high key combination counts that make unauthorized entry significantly more difficult.

 

A security cam lock uses a disc tumbler locking cylinder with 6 to 14 individual discs. Across the Security Cam Lock product line, this produces from 5,000 to over 100,000 distinct key combinations depending on the disc configuration. Each disc must align precisely for the key to rotate, creating a mechanism that resists both picking and key duplication. Jin Tay's Security Cam Lock line adds a steel ball in the drill face of the cylinder, which prevents a drill bit from gaining purchase and penetrating the lock core.

1. How a Cam Lock Cylinder Works: The Foundation of Security

All cam locks follow the same fundamental mechanical principle: inserting and turning the correct key rotates an internal cam (the rotating arm) to engage or disengage the fastener. Where high-security cam locks differ is in the cylinder design that controls key recognition.

 

Standard Pin Tumbler vs. Disc Tumbler Cylinder Design

Most cam locks use either pin tumbler or disc tumbler cylinders. Pin tumblers are common in general door hardware. Disc tumbler cylinders — used in security cam locks — consist of a series of flat rotating discs, each with a slot. All slots must align for the key to rotate.

 

Jin Tay's Security Cam Lock line uses 6 to 14 discs to accommodate different customer security requirements. The higher the disc count, the greater the number of possible key alignments — and the more time-consuming and technically demanding picking becomes.

 

2. Anti-Drill Steel Ball Protection

One of the most common forced-entry methods for cam locks is to drill directly into the cylinder face with a high-speed bit, destroying the internal mechanism. Standard cam locks can be vulnerable to this because the cylinder face provides a flat, stable surface for a bit to grip.

 

How Jin Tay Security Cam Lock Anti-Drill Protection Works

On models equipped with this feature, a hardened steel ball is embedded at the drill-point position on the cylinder face. When a drill contacts this position, the ball rotates freely, preventing the bit from gripping, gaining friction, or penetrating the cylinder. Without a stable drill point, forced-entry attempts fail. The steel ball does not affect normal key operation.

 

This feature is particularly relevant for unmanned environments — vending equipment (19mm models), industrial control cabinets, and server enclosures — where physical access cannot always be monitored in real time. Key combination counts are model-specific within the line — individual models range from several thousand combinations up to 100,000+ at the top of the range. A cam lock system deployed across hundreds of units needs a combination count large enough to prevent accidental cross-keying, where two locks in the same facility open with the same key.

 

Key Numbers — Individual Lock Identification

Jin Tay's cam lock range offers individual key numbers scaled to deployment size — up to 50,000 key numbers depending on the product structure. This allows procurement teams to assign unique key numbers to individual locks across an entire facility, enabling systematic key management, re-issue tracking, and audit control without requiring a locksmith for every change.

 

Master Key Program: 10,000 Locks to One Master Key

For large deployments, Jin Tay offers a master key system: up to 10,000 individual lock heads can be keyed to operate with a single master key while still using unique change keys for individual locks. This is standard in environments such as filing room furniture arrays, vending bank installations, or equipment rack clusters where maintenance access must be centralized.

5. Cam Lock Limitations: Selecting the Right Security Tier

Even high-security cam locks are not appropriate for every application. Understanding their limitations helps procurement engineers make the correct product selection.

 

 Application scope: Cam locks are mechanical devices — they do not support remote access management, audit logging, or digital authorization. For these requirements, refer to Jin Tay's Smart Locker Lock series.

 Load capacity: The cam mechanism is designed for cabinet, drawer, and panel applications — not for high-load applications where the cam arm is a primary load-bearing component.

 Weather resistance: IP protection varies by model. Certain Security Cam Lock models are designed for corrosion-resistant marine and pool locker environments — confirm the target model's rating with Jin Tay before specifying.

 Application fit: Cam locks are not substitutes for high-security perimeter padlocks. Their designed use is controlling access to panels, cabinets, and enclosures.

Q: Can cam locks be drilled open?

A: Standard cam locks can be vulnerable to drilling at the cylinder face. Jin Tay Security Cam Lock models with anti-drill protection embed a hardened steel ball at the cylinder drill point — when a drill contacts this position, the ball rotates freely and prevents the bit from gripping or penetrating. This does not make drilling physically impossible under all conditions, but it substantially increases the time and skill a forced-entry attempt requires.
